IAM系统的主要功能有哪些?
在当今信息化时代,身份认证与访问管理(Identity and Access Management,IAM)系统已成为企业信息安全的重要组成部分。IAM系统通过集中管理用户身份验证、权限控制和审计跟踪等功能,确保企业资源的安全性和合规性。本文将详细介绍IAM系统的主要功能,以帮助读者更好地了解其在企业安全中的应用。
一、用户身份验证
用户身份验证是IAM系统的核心功能之一,其主要目的是确保只有授权用户才能访问企业资源。以下是IAM系统在用户身份验证方面的主要功能:
多因素认证:IAM系统支持多种身份验证方式,如密码、指纹、面部识别等,通过多因素认证,提高用户身份验证的安全性。
单点登录(SSO):单点登录允许用户在多个应用程序和系统中使用一个统一的登录凭证,简化用户登录过程,提高用户体验。
自助服务:IAM系统提供自助服务功能,用户可以在线重置密码、修改个人信息等,降低IT部门的工作量。
用户认证审计:IAM系统记录用户登录、注销等操作,为安全事件调查提供依据。
二、权限控制
权限控制是IAM系统的另一项重要功能,旨在确保用户只能访问其权限范围内的资源。以下是IAM系统在权限控制方面的主要功能:
角色管理:IAM系统通过定义角色,将用户分组,并为每个角色分配相应的权限。管理员可以根据角色分配权限,简化权限管理。
细粒度权限控制:IAM系统支持细粒度权限控制,允许管理员为用户或角色分配特定资源的访问权限。
权限审批:在权限变更过程中,IAM系统可以实现权限审批流程,确保权限变更的合规性。
权限审计:IAM系统记录用户对资源的访问和操作,为安全事件调查提供依据。
三、用户生命周期管理
用户生命周期管理是IAM系统的一项重要功能,它涵盖用户从创建到离职的整个生命周期。以下是IAM系统在用户生命周期管理方面的主要功能:
用户创建:IAM系统支持批量创建用户,提高用户管理效率。
用户变更:IAM系统允许管理员修改用户信息,如姓名、部门、邮箱等。
用户离职:当用户离职时,IAM系统可以自动回收其权限,防止数据泄露。
用户激活/禁用:管理员可以根据需要,对用户进行激活或禁用操作。
四、合规性管理
合规性管理是IAM系统的一项重要功能,旨在确保企业遵守相关法律法规和行业标准。以下是IAM系统在合规性管理方面的主要功能:
政策制定:IAM系统支持制定企业内部安全政策,确保用户遵守相关规定。
政策执行:IAM系统自动执行安全政策,如密码策略、登录策略等。
合规性审计:IAM系统记录用户操作,为合规性审计提供依据。
合规性报告:IAM系统生成合规性报告,帮助企业管理合规性风险。
五、集成与扩展
IAM系统需要与其他系统进行集成,以实现统一的安全管理。以下是IAM系统在集成与扩展方面的主要功能:
API接口:IAM系统提供API接口,方便与其他系统进行集成。
标准协议支持:IAM系统支持标准安全协议,如SAML、OAuth等。
扩展性:IAM系统具有良好的扩展性,可以根据企业需求进行功能扩展。
总之,IAM系统通过用户身份验证、权限控制、用户生命周期管理、合规性管理和集成与扩展等功能,为企业提供全面的安全保障。在信息化时代,企业应重视IAM系统的建设,以提高信息安全水平,降低安全风险。
猜你喜欢:语聊房